Gillian Seaman

Gillian has always been involved in the arts. She started singing with the Canadian Children's Opera Chorus, and later, The South Simcoe Youth Choir, and Toronto Diocesan Choir School for Girls. Gillian attended March Break theatre camps at the Gibson Centre through Talk Is Free Theatre. She was also heavily involved in music in high school, participating in Concert Band, Jazz Band, and Choir, as well as holding the positions of Music Librarian and President of the Music Council, and a Peer Tutor for the Vocal Music Class. Gillian has also enjoyed singing with the Sugartones, a local women's barbershop group.
